RRID:Addgene_31602 BoNT/A LC Ampicillin PMID:18940613 The author states that although the construct is from a toxic protein, it only contains one third of the biologically active protein,i.e., it is inactive and harmless per se, and it does not require BL4 level for its expression/manipulation. Toxic BoNT/A is made of two 'chains' (i.e. polypeptides) linked to each other by one disulfide bond. The light chain (LC) is 50KDa long, whereas the heavy chain (HC) is 100 KDa. The HC is necessary for the toxin to target and enter motorneurons. This construct is the LC of BoNTA, and it completely lacks the HC, so it is unable to intoxicate neurons.
